using a samsung Hd935 player, hooked up via dvi to Ae500
image is amazing, on 1080i........
you can really notice a BIG improvement..........it gets rid of all jaggies, and the image just becomes very film like, its just a day and night improvement.....
on standard mode, its a good image, but u can see the jaggies, and see its a digital medium res picture
upscale to 720, and its immediately better
BUT, going to 1080i is just so much better...........this is the best image Ive ever seen from dvd
the only downside, is unless the film has been mastered perfectly, you do get some grain in the image
on Bat.begins, its perfect on 1080i
really depends on the quality of the dvd........
interestingly, on the samsung logo screen, on standard res., again, u can see the jagged edges, around the logo
upsampling, to 720 increases the quality
and at 1080 is virtually perfectly smooth
and this is on a 7' diagonal projected image
the 935 uses Faroudja circuits, and Im guessing they are the key to the excellent image
from this experience, I can say upscaling works, and works really really well....not just a minor improvment, but a real wow factor
